
How to Build an AI-Driven Prospecting System That Attracts Better Freelance Clients
A high-level playbook for freelancers who want a consistent stream of qualified clients using AI tools and structured outreach. It explains how to blend automation with human judgment to increase response rates and win better projects.
For freelancers and independent professionals, inconsistent client pipelines create stress, uncertainty, and feast-or-famine cycles. Traditional prospecting methods—scrolling directories, sending generic cold emails, hoping referrals materialize—are time-intensive, emotionally draining, and increasingly ineffective. This guide presents a practical AI-driven prospecting system that replaces guesswork with structure, improves targeting precision, and generates higher-quality client conversations without requiring deep technical expertise. By blending AI prospecting tools with human judgment, you can build a repeatable workflow that delivers predictable results and attracts better-fit clients.
The Problem
Most freelancers operate without a structured client acquisition system. They rely on broad, unfocused outreach across multiple platforms, manually researching potential clients one by one, and crafting generic messages that rarely generate responses. This approach creates several fundamental problems:
- Unpredictable pipeline flow that makes revenue forecasting impossible
- Wasted time on unqualified leads who lack budget or decision-making authority
- Low response rates from impersonal, templated outreach
- Burnout from constant manual research and follow-up tracking
- Missed opportunities because promising leads fall through tracking gaps
The core issue isn't effort—most freelancers work hard at prospecting. The problem is inefficient workflow architecture that doesn't leverage modern AI productivity tools to handle repetitive research, data organization, and initial drafting work.
The Promise
A structured AI prospecting system transforms client acquisition from reactive hope into proactive process. By combining AI-powered lead discovery with human verification and personalized outreach, you create a scalable workflow that consistently produces higher-quality conversations.
What This System Delivers
Professional freelancers using this approach report predictable weekly pipelines, improved response rates from targeted prospects, reduced time spent on manual research, and better client fit leading to more successful engagements. The system feels effortless because AI handles the volume work while you focus on relationship-building and personalization.
The goal isn't to automate everything—it's to use AI strategically for research and organization while maintaining the human judgment that separates effective outreach from spam. This balance creates professional client acquisition that scales without losing the personal touch that wins business.
The System Model
Understanding how an AI-driven prospecting system works requires examining its core components, key behaviors, inputs and outputs, success indicators, and potential risks. This framework helps you build a workflow that fits your specific client acquisition needs.
Core Components
The system consists of five essential elements working together:
- Clearly defined buyer persona: Specific attributes including industry vertical, company size, geographic location, decision-maker roles, and business characteristics that indicate good client fit
- AI-powered search tools: Prospecting platforms that surface relevant businesses and contacts based on your criteria, handling the volume research work traditional methods require hours to complete
- Generative AI assistant: Tools like ChatGPT or Claude that help organize extracted data, identify patterns, draft initial outreach messages, and maintain consistency across communications
- Manual verification step: Human review ensuring each lead actually matches your criteria, contact information is current, and the opportunity represents genuine fit before investing outreach effort
- Follow-up rhythm: Structured cadence for checking in with prospects, tracking responses, and nurturing relationships without becoming pushy or overwhelming
Key Behaviors
Success with this system depends on consistent execution of specific practices:
- Tight persona construction: Starting with narrow, specific targeting criteria rather than broad categories improves match quality and response rates significantly
- Reviewing each lead for accuracy: Taking time to verify fit before outreach prevents wasted effort on poor matches and maintains your professional reputation
- Personalizing communication meaningfully: Adding small but relevant details—mentioning a recent company milestone, referencing specific business challenges—transforms generic messages into professional outreach
- Maintaining consistent weekly cadence: Regular execution builds pipeline predictability and keeps opportunities moving forward without requiring constant attention
Inputs & Outputs
Understanding what goes into the system and what comes out helps clarify the workflow:
System Flow
Inputs: Persona criteria specifying ideal client attributes, target geographic regions, business characteristics indicating need and fit, decision-maker role definitions, and contact detail requirements.
Outputs: Verified lead lists with accurate contact information, tailored outreach messages that reference specific business context, scheduled follow-up reminders maintaining consistent touch points, and response tracking enabling pipeline visibility.
What Good Looks Like
Recognizing successful implementation helps you calibrate execution:
- High signal-to-noise in your lead list—most prospects actually match your ideal client profile
- Outreach emails that feel tailored and professional, not automated or generic
- Predictable weekly pipeline activity you can forecast and plan around
- Positive responses from international prospects within days, not weeks
- Conversations with decision-makers who have authority and budget
- Reduced time spent on prospecting while maintaining or improving results
Risks & Constraints
Understanding limitations helps you navigate challenges effectively:
- Limited credits from AI prospecting tools: Most platforms use credit-based pricing, requiring strategic use rather than unlimited searching
- Poor results from vague personas: Broad targeting criteria generate large volumes of low-quality leads that waste verification time
- Over-automation leading to impersonal outreach: Completely automated messages lack the human touch that wins professional services business
- Skipping verification resulting in wasted effort: Sending outreach to poorly-matched leads damages your reputation and produces no results
- Inconsistent execution breaking pipeline flow: Irregular prospecting creates the same feast-or-famine cycles the system aims to solve
Practical Implementation Guide
Building an effective AI prospecting system requires following specific steps in sequence. This implementation guide walks through the complete workflow from persona definition to response management.
Step 1: Define Your Ultra-Specific Buyer Persona
Start by documenting precise characteristics of your ideal client. Include industry vertical, company size (revenue or employee count), geographic location, decision-maker roles, business stage, and specific attributes indicating need for your services. The more specific your criteria, the higher quality your leads will be. Avoid broad categories like "all marketing agencies"—instead target "50-200 person ecommerce marketing agencies in Western Europe serving direct-to-consumer brands."
Step 2: Use AI Prospecting Tools to Extract Relevant Contacts
Select an AI prospecting platform (such as Apollo.io, LinkedIn Sales Navigator, or similar tools) and configure searches using your persona criteria. Work within your credit limits by running targeted searches rather than broad sweeps. Extract companies and contacts that match your specifications, focusing on decision-maker roles with authority over hiring external professionals. Export results in CSV or spreadsheet format for the next processing step.
Step 3: Organize Data with a Generative AI Assistant
Upload your exported lead list to a generative AI tool like ChatGPT or Claude. Ask it to help clean and organize the data—removing duplicates, standardizing formatting, identifying missing information, and flagging potential issues. The AI assistant can spot patterns you might miss and structure information for easier manual review. This step transforms raw export data into a workable lead list.
Step 4: Manually Verify Each Lead
Review every lead individually to confirm they actually match your persona criteria. Check company websites to verify business focus, confirm decision-maker roles through LinkedIn profiles, validate contact information accuracy, and assess genuine fit with your services. This verification step is critical—it prevents wasted outreach effort and maintains your professional reputation. Remove leads that don't meet your standards regardless of what the AI search returned.
Step 5: Prepare Outreach Messages with AI Assistance
Use your generative AI assistant to draft initial outreach messages based on verified lead information. Provide the AI with context about your services, the prospect's business, and relevant details from your research. The AI can generate message frameworks that you'll personalize in the next step. Focus on creating value-oriented messages that clearly explain why you're reaching out and what benefit you offer.
Step 6: Personalize Each Email Meaningfully
Add specific, relevant details to each AI-drafted message. Include the decision-maker's name, reference a recent company announcement or achievement, mention a specific business challenge your research revealed, or connect your outreach to their industry context. These small personalizations transform generic messages into professional communications that demonstrate you've done your homework. Even one or two personalized sentences significantly improve response rates.
Step 7: Send Outreach in Manageable Batches
Rather than sending hundreds of emails at once, work in small batches of 10-20 prospects. This approach makes personalization manageable, allows you to adjust messaging based on early responses, and prevents overwhelming yourself with reply management. Batch sending also helps you maintain consistency and quality throughout your outreach campaign.
Step 8: Follow Up Weekly with Short Reminders
Create a simple system for tracking follow-ups and send brief, friendly reminders to non-responders after one week. Keep follow-up messages short—simply reference your previous email and ask if they'd like to discuss further. Maintain professional persistence without becoming pushy. Two to three follow-ups total is typically appropriate before moving on.
Step 9: Track Responses and Manage Conversations
Use a simple spreadsheet or CRM to track all outreach activity, responses, scheduled calls, and outcomes. Handle rejections professionally—thank prospects for their time and ask if you can check back in the future. For positive responses, move quickly to schedule calls and continue the conversation. This tracking creates visibility into your pipeline and helps you identify what's working.
Examples & Use Cases
Real-world applications demonstrate how this system works across different freelance specialties and client types.
Designer Targeting Mid-Sized Ecommerce Brands
A brand designer defined their persona as 50-200 employee ecommerce companies in Western Europe selling physical products direct-to-consumer. Using AI prospecting tools, they extracted 150 companies matching these criteria, verified each one manually by reviewing their websites and LinkedIn presence, and sent personalized outreach referencing each company's current branding. Within one week, they received positive replies from prospects in Germany, France, and the UK, with three scheduling discovery calls. The tight targeting and personalization made their outreach stand out from generic agency pitches.
Consultant Filtering to Founder-Level Contacts
A business consultant refined their AI search criteria to only return founders and C-level executives at Series A and B SaaS companies in North America. This filtering ensured every conversation happened with decision-makers who had authority to hire consultants without lengthy approval processes. By verifying each contact's role through LinkedIn and personalizing outreach based on company funding announcements, they achieved a 15% positive response rate—significantly higher than industry averages for cold outreach.
Developer Refining Persona After Initial Results
A freelance developer initially targeted "all fintech companies" but noticed most leads were poor fits. After reviewing response patterns, they refined their persona to specifically target Series B fintech companies building consumer mobile apps who had recently hired product managers—indicating active development needs. This persona adjustment dramatically improved lead quality, reduced verification time, and increased meaningful conversations with prospects who had immediate development needs.
Tips, Pitfalls & Best Practices
Successful implementation requires avoiding common mistakes and following proven practices that improve results.
Best Practices for Maximum Effectiveness
- Start narrow with persona targeting: Tight initial criteria improve match quality and give you room to expand later if needed. It's easier to broaden successful targeting than fix overly broad approaches.
- Use AI to speed up drafting, not replace personalization: Leverage AI for research organization and message frameworks, but always add human touches that demonstrate genuine interest in each prospect.
- Keep follow-ups brief and consistent: Short reminder messages maintain presence without annoying prospects. Consistency matters more than perfect timing.
- Refresh persona assumptions monthly: Review response patterns regularly and adjust targeting criteria based on what's actually working, not what you assumed would work.
- Don't rely solely on automation: Human review at verification and personalization stages significantly improves conversion rates and protects your professional reputation.
Common Pitfalls to Avoid
- Skipping manual verification: Trusting AI search results without verification leads to wasted outreach on poor-fit prospects
- Over-automating personalization: Completely automated messages lack authenticity and generate poor response rates
- Inconsistent execution: Running prospecting campaigns sporadically recreates the pipeline unpredictability you're trying to solve
- Ignoring response data: Failing to track what messaging and targeting works means you can't optimize over time
- Targeting too broadly: Vague persona criteria generate high volumes of low-quality leads that waste verification time
The Verification-Personalization Balance
The most successful freelancers using this system spend roughly equal time on verification and personalization. Thorough verification ensures you only invest personalization effort in qualified prospects, while meaningful personalization converts verified leads into conversations. Skimping on either step undermines the entire system's effectiveness.
Extensions & Variants
Once you've established a basic AI prospecting workflow, several enhancements can increase effectiveness and efficiency.
Adding Lead Scoring to Prioritize High-Value Targets
Implement a simple scoring system that ranks verified leads based on fit, budget indicators, urgency signals, and decision-maker accessibility. Focus personalization effort on high-scoring prospects first, ensuring your best work goes to the most promising opportunities. Your AI assistant can help structure scoring criteria based on your success patterns.
Offering Pre-Call Value in Follow-Ups
Rather than generic follow-up reminders, provide small pieces of value in subsequent messages—sharing a relevant article, offering a quick insight about their industry, or pointing out an opportunity you noticed. This approach demonstrates expertise and makes follow-ups welcome rather than annoying.
Expanding Outreach to New Regions Through AI Filtering
Once you've proven your system in one geographic market, use AI prospecting tools to expand into new regions with similar business characteristics. The AI handles the volume research work required to enter new markets, while your verification process ensures quality remains consistent across geographies.
Creating a Weekly Pipeline Dashboard
Build a simple tracking dashboard showing weekly outreach activity, response rates, calls scheduled, and proposals sent. This visibility helps you forecast revenue, identify bottlenecks, and maintain consistent execution. Your AI assistant can help structure the dashboard and even analyze trends over time.
From System to Competitive Advantage
Professional freelancers who implement structured AI prospecting systems consistently report that client acquisition becomes their competitive advantage rather than their biggest challenge. The combination of AI efficiency with human judgment creates a workflow that scales without losing the personal touch that wins business. As you refine your system over time, prospecting transforms from draining uncertainty into predictable pipeline generation that supports sustainable freelance success.
Related Articles
AI Automation for Accounting: Ending Month-End Madness Forever
Stop the manual grind of month-end reconciliations. Learn how to implement AI-driven systems for invoice processing, expense categorization, and automated client document collection to save hours every month.
AI Automation for Construction: From Bid Management to Project Closeout
Master the field-to-office workflow with AI-driven systems. Learn how to automate RFI processing, daily reporting, and bid management to increase project mar...
AI Automation for E-Commerce: Scaling Operations Without Scaling Headcount
Scale your Shopify or WooCommerce store with AI-driven systems. Learn how to automate abandoned cart recovery, inventory management, and customer support to ...